4.10 Selecting an Averaging Method
Measurement Functions Used in Harmonic Measurement (Optional)
4-28
Turning Averaging On or Off
• If averaging is turned on, and the averaging type is Exp (exponential averaging),
averaging is performed on harmonic measurement functions.
• Even if averaging is turned on, if the averaging type is Lin (moving average),
averaging is not performed on harmonic measurement functions.
Setting the Attenuation Constant
If averaging is turned on, and the averaging type is Exp (exponential averaging),
exponential averaging is performed using the selected attenuation constant (2, 4, 8, 16,
32, or 64).
Measurement Functions That Are Averaged
The measurement functions that are directly averaged are indicated below. Other
functions that use these functions in their computation are also affected by averaging.
For details about how each measurement function is determined, see appendix 1.
• U(k), I(k), P(k), S(k), and Q(k)
• λ(k), and f(k) are computed using P(k) and Q(k), which are both averaged.
• Uhdf, Ihdf, Phdf, Uthd, Ithd, and Pthd are computed using U(k), I(k), and P(k), which
are all averaged.
* k: The harmonic order
Note
When averaging is turned on, the average value of multiple measurements is determined
and displayed. If the input signal changes drastically, it will take longer for the change to be
reflected in the measured values when averaging is used.
A larger attenuation constant (for exponential averaging) or average count (for moving
averages) will result in more stable (and less responsive) measured values.
